talk @ make: tokyo meeting 02
TRANSCRIPT
![Page 1: Talk @ Make: Tokyo Meeting 02](https://reader036.vdocuments.us/reader036/viewer/2022081403/5559261ad8b42a3d028b5510/html5/thumbnails/1.jpg)
Making Things Talk刊行記念トーク
久保田晃弘船田戦闘機小林茂
![Page 2: Talk @ Make: Tokyo Meeting 02](https://reader036.vdocuments.us/reader036/viewer/2022081403/5559261ad8b42a3d028b5510/html5/thumbnails/2.jpg)
メンバー紹介
• 久保田晃弘[多摩美術大学教授]• 船田戦闘機[メディア技術者・Make: Japan blog筆者]• 小林茂[MTT監訳者・Gainer / Funnel開発者・IAMAS准教授]
![Page 3: Talk @ Make: Tokyo Meeting 02](https://reader036.vdocuments.us/reader036/viewer/2022081403/5559261ad8b42a3d028b5510/html5/thumbnails/3.jpg)
イントロダクション
• フィジカルコンピューティングとは?• Arduinoとは?
![Page 4: Talk @ Make: Tokyo Meeting 02](https://reader036.vdocuments.us/reader036/viewer/2022081403/5559261ad8b42a3d028b5510/html5/thumbnails/4.jpg)
フィジカルコンピューティングとは?
• ニューヨーク大学の ITP*1でTom Igoeらが中心となって教えているコースの名前
• インタラクションデザインを教えるための方法の1つ
• コンピュータが理解したり反応できる人間のフィジカルな表現の幅をいかに増やすか
• デザインやアート教育の1つの分野として定着
*1 Interactive Telecommunications Program
![Page 5: Talk @ Make: Tokyo Meeting 02](https://reader036.vdocuments.us/reader036/viewer/2022081403/5559261ad8b42a3d028b5510/html5/thumbnails/5.jpg)
フィジカルコンピューティング関連書籍
Physical ComputingSensing and Controlling the Physical World with Computers
Dan O’Sullivan and Tom Igoe(Course Technology Ptr・2004年)
![Page 6: Talk @ Make: Tokyo Meeting 02](https://reader036.vdocuments.us/reader036/viewer/2022081403/5559261ad8b42a3d028b5510/html5/thumbnails/6.jpg)
フィジカルコンピューティング関連書籍
Making Things TalkArduinoで作る「会話」するモノたち
Tom Igoe 著・小林 茂監訳・水原文翻訳(オライリー・2008年)
![Page 7: Talk @ Make: Tokyo Meeting 02](https://reader036.vdocuments.us/reader036/viewer/2022081403/5559261ad8b42a3d028b5510/html5/thumbnails/7.jpg)
フィジカルコンピューティング関連書籍
Getting Started with ArduinoThe open source electronics prototyping platform
Massimo Banzi(O’Reilly Media・2008年)
![Page 8: Talk @ Make: Tokyo Meeting 02](https://reader036.vdocuments.us/reader036/viewer/2022081403/5559261ad8b42a3d028b5510/html5/thumbnails/8.jpg)
フィジカルコンピューティングの構成要素
• センサ(例:光、圧力、音、温度、加速度など)• アクチュエータ(例:LED、モータ、ソレノイドなど)• プロセッサ(例:マイコン、I/Oモジュール+PCなど)
→ものすごく簡単にまとめると プログラミング+電子工作
![Page 9: Talk @ Make: Tokyo Meeting 02](https://reader036.vdocuments.us/reader036/viewer/2022081403/5559261ad8b42a3d028b5510/html5/thumbnails/9.jpg)
フィジカルな世界とつなぐ方法
マイコンのみa
b
c
d
A
B
C
D
マイコンmicrocontroller
program
a0]=ain.o;aout.1 = 255;
![Page 10: Talk @ Make: Tokyo Meeting 02](https://reader036.vdocuments.us/reader036/viewer/2022081403/5559261ad8b42a3d028b5510/html5/thumbnails/10.jpg)
フィジカルな世界とつなぐ方法
マイコン+PC
a
b
c
d
A
B
C
D
マイコンmicrocontroller
PC
USB
program
a0]=ain.o;aout.1 = 255;
program
a0]=ain.o;aout.1 = 255;
![Page 11: Talk @ Make: Tokyo Meeting 02](https://reader036.vdocuments.us/reader036/viewer/2022081403/5559261ad8b42a3d028b5510/html5/thumbnails/11.jpg)
フィジカルな世界とつなぐ方法
I/Oモジュール+PC(GainerやPhidgetsなど)a
b
c
d
A
B
C
D
I/OモジュールI/O module
PC
USB
program
a0]=ain.o;aout.1 = 255;
![Page 12: Talk @ Make: Tokyo Meeting 02](https://reader036.vdocuments.us/reader036/viewer/2022081403/5559261ad8b42a3d028b5510/html5/thumbnails/12.jpg)
Arduinoとは?
• Hernando Barraganが IDII*2にいた時に開発を始めたWiringがベース
• 電子回路をプロトタイピングするためのオープンソースのプラットフォーム
• IDEとArduino I/Oボードから構成される
*2 Interaction Design Institute Ivrea
![Page 13: Talk @ Make: Tokyo Meeting 02](https://reader036.vdocuments.us/reader036/viewer/2022081403/5559261ad8b42a3d028b5510/html5/thumbnails/13.jpg)
Wiring
写真:SparkFun Electronics
![Page 14: Talk @ Make: Tokyo Meeting 02](https://reader036.vdocuments.us/reader036/viewer/2022081403/5559261ad8b42a3d028b5510/html5/thumbnails/14.jpg)
Arduino Duemilanove
写真:SparkFun Electronics
![Page 15: Talk @ Make: Tokyo Meeting 02](https://reader036.vdocuments.us/reader036/viewer/2022081403/5559261ad8b42a3d028b5510/html5/thumbnails/15.jpg)
Arduino IDE
![Page 16: Talk @ Make: Tokyo Meeting 02](https://reader036.vdocuments.us/reader036/viewer/2022081403/5559261ad8b42a3d028b5510/html5/thumbnails/16.jpg)
オープンソース・ハードウェアとは?
• ハードウェアのデザインデータがオープン– 回路図– 基板レイアウト
• ライセンスに基づいて自由に改変できる
![Page 17: Talk @ Make: Tokyo Meeting 02](https://reader036.vdocuments.us/reader036/viewer/2022081403/5559261ad8b42a3d028b5510/html5/thumbnails/17.jpg)
LilyPad Arduino
写真:SparkFun Electronics
![Page 18: Talk @ Make: Tokyo Meeting 02](https://reader036.vdocuments.us/reader036/viewer/2022081403/5559261ad8b42a3d028b5510/html5/thumbnails/18.jpg)
Arduino Pro Mini
写真:SparkFun Electronics
![Page 19: Talk @ Make: Tokyo Meeting 02](https://reader036.vdocuments.us/reader036/viewer/2022081403/5559261ad8b42a3d028b5510/html5/thumbnails/19.jpg)
Arduino ProtoShield
写真:SparkFun Electronics
![Page 20: Talk @ Make: Tokyo Meeting 02](https://reader036.vdocuments.us/reader036/viewer/2022081403/5559261ad8b42a3d028b5510/html5/thumbnails/20.jpg)
Arduino XBee Shield
写真:SparkFun Electronics
![Page 21: Talk @ Make: Tokyo Meeting 02](https://reader036.vdocuments.us/reader036/viewer/2022081403/5559261ad8b42a3d028b5510/html5/thumbnails/21.jpg)
FIO: Funnel I/O Module v1.0
![Page 22: Talk @ Make: Tokyo Meeting 02](https://reader036.vdocuments.us/reader036/viewer/2022081403/5559261ad8b42a3d028b5510/html5/thumbnails/22.jpg)
Making Things Talkの紹介
扱っているテクノロジー
• Arduino• Processing / PHP• Ethernet• Bluetooth• IEEE 802.15.4 / ZigBee• RFID• 基本的なCV
![Page 23: Talk @ Make: Tokyo Meeting 02](https://reader036.vdocuments.us/reader036/viewer/2022081403/5559261ad8b42a3d028b5510/html5/thumbnails/23.jpg)
Making Things Talkの紹介
さまざまなプロジェクト
• モンスキーポン• ネットワークに接続された猫• ネットワーク大気清浄度計• 太陽電池のデータをワイヤレス中継• デジタルコンパスを使って進路を知る• ウェブカムを用いた2次元バーコード認識• RFIDを使ったホームオートメーション
![Page 24: Talk @ Make: Tokyo Meeting 02](https://reader036.vdocuments.us/reader036/viewer/2022081403/5559261ad8b42a3d028b5510/html5/thumbnails/24.jpg)
Making Things Talk刊行記念トーク
久保田晃弘船田戦闘機小林茂